For the 2025-26 school year, there are 4 public schools serving 2,140 students in Rockland School District. This district's average testing ranking is 5/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public schools in Massachusetts.
51±¬ÁÏs in Rockland School District have an average math proficiency score of 44% (versus the Massachusetts public school average of 43%), and reading proficiency score of 42% (versus the 45%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 34%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Massachusetts public school average of 47% (majority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$23,513 in this school district is less than the state median of $23,847.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$25,492 is higher than the state median of $24,604.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
